OneNotary is built using a modern, cloud-native architecture designed for scalability, security, and reliability. Our platform leverages secure cloud infrastructure, encrypted video technology for remote sessions, advanced identity verification systems, and API-based integrations to support fully embedded business workflows.
We utilize industry-standard development and version control systems (including GitLab), secure data storage with encryption at rest and in transit, and structured compliance controls aligned with SOC 2 and ISO 27001 frameworks. Our technology stack is designed to support high-availability performance, enterprise integrations, and secure handling of sensitive legal and financial documentation.

OneNotary was founded to modernize and professionalize the notarization experience for businesses operating in an increasingly digital world. As industries like mortgage, legal, and financial services moved online, notarization remained fragmented, inconsistent, and often operationally inefficient. We saw an opportunity to build a secure, enterprise-grade Remote Online Notarization (RON) platform designed specifically for business workflows โ not just one-off consumer transactions.
From the beginning, our focus has been on combining trusted technology with a highly vetted network of top-performing notaries. By prioritizing compliance, security, scalability, and integration with leading SaaS platforms, OneNotary was built to serve organizations ranging from SMBs to Fortune 500 companies. Today, we continue to expand access to reliable, 24/7 on-demand notarization while maintaining the highest standards of trust and operational excellence.
